What is Hyde Park Chicago famous for?

A culturally diverse area, Hyde Park in Chicago is known as the site for the Chicago World’s Fair of 1893, as well as the home of former President Barack Obama, and the home for the renowned University of Chicago. Some of Chicago’s most notable citizens have come from the Hyde Park area.

How long is the walk around Hyde Park?

CENTRAL LONDON PARK PERIMETERS

Park Miles KM
Hyde Park 3.0 4.8
Hyde Park – Serpentine Loop 2.1 3.3
Kensington Gardens 2.7 4.3
Hyde & Kensington 4.3 7.0

How far is the walk around Hyde Park?

4.3mi
Most runners will incorporate portions of both parks into their run and a full loop around the perimeter of the entire area is 4.3mi (7.0km). Hyde Park | A perimeter of Hyde Park, following the trails closest to the fence line, is 3mi (4.8km).

Is Hyde Park a black neighborhood?

Hyde Park is a very racially diverse neighborhood. Its population is 47.6% White, 26.8% African American, 12.1% Asian American, 8.5% Hispanic, and 5.0% of other races or of more than one race.

What is the whitest neighborhood in Chicago?

A WBEZ analysis of newly released census data show that Chicago’s Logan Square neighborhood is now majority white. The number of white residents in the neighborhood has been rising sharply the past two decades, surpassing the Latino population in 2017.
